As long as the change in the wording from 20% of the language spoken by the citizens to Albanian is not introduced, Besa MPs will not vote on the constitutional amendments, said the leader of the Besa movement, Bilal Kasami, in an interview with RFE/RL.
Kasami says that before the election there is no possibility of any combination with VMRO-DPMNE, and with any other Macedonian opposition party.
“The society in Macedonia is not ready for such combinations and unfortunately, I can already state that we are returning to the ethnic votes and the parties will run and will compete in that ethnic campus in order to go after the post-election combinatorics who will form a coalition with whom for the Government,” said the Besa leader.
